Minnesota to Give 6,000 Hunters and Trappers the Chance to Kill Wolves

Minnesota is amping up for a wolf season, and the Department of Natural Resources has laid out their plans for public comment. The DNR is planning on giving 6,000 hunters and trappers the chance to take up to 400 wolves in their first season. According to NECN.com, there are about 3,000 wolves in the state, [...]

British Fox Hunters Guilty of Using Hound Dogs

When thinking about British hunting, there is almost always a dog that comes to mind and the words Tally Ho!, but that has not been the case since 2004 when the country outlawed hunting mammals with dogs. But three members of a Sussex hunt were found guilty of using hounds on fox hunts in early [...]
